About 35 Whitford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

35 Whitford Road is a mid-terrace house in Birkenhead (CH42 7HZ). It has a recorded floor area of 118 m² (around 1270 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(March 2019)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home.

At 118 m² the property is well over the postcode median (90 m² across 30 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2007–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£146,000 sits 62.2% above the 2023 sale of £90,000. Last sale on file: £90,000 in December 2023.
